| When I was abroad last year, I found some great rugs and I couldn’t turn my eyes from it. But, when merchant told me the price, I was awfully disappointed. So, I started moving on, and he stopped me offering me, believe or not, half lower price that it was for the first time. I couldn’t believe, but I accepted the game. So, I offered him less, and eventually we’ve reached some reasonable price. So, if you are foreign buyer, you should always try to lower the price, especially if it seems far too big. |
